Just How Solar Panels Generate Electricity



Photovoltaic panel harness the sunlight's power by converting sunlight into electrical energy through a process referred to as the photovoltaic or pv effect. When sunlight hits the photovoltaic panels, the photons (light fragments) are taken in by the semiconducting materials within the panels, usually made from silicon. This absorption produces an electrical existing as the photons knock electrons loosened from the atoms within the material.

The electric fields within the solar batteries then compel these electrons to stream in a particular direction, developing a direct present (DC) of power. This direct current is then travelled through an inverter, which transforms it right into alternating current (A/C) power that can be utilized to power your home or organization.

Excess electricity produced by the solar panels can be saved in batteries for later usage or fed back right into the grid for credit score with a procedure called web metering. Understanding just how photovoltaic panels generate electrical power is vital to appreciating the ecological and cost-saving benefits of solar power systems.

Understanding Solar Panel Parts



One vital facet of photovoltaic panel modern technology is comprehending the different parts that compose a photovoltaic panel system.

The essential elements of a solar panel system include the solar panels themselves, which are comprised of solar batteries that transform sunlight right into electrical energy. These panels are mounted on a framework, usually a roofing system, to catch sunlight.

In addition to the panels, there are inverters that transform the straight existing (DC) electrical energy created by the panels right into alternating existing (A/C) power that can be made use of in homes or companies.

The system additionally includes racking to support and place the photovoltaic panels for ideal sunlight direct exposure. Moreover, cables and connectors are necessary for transferring the electrical energy generated by the panels to the electrical system of a building.

Lastly, a monitoring system may be consisted of to track the efficiency of the solar panel system and guarantee it's functioning effectively. Understanding these parts is crucial for any individual seeking to install or make use of solar panel innovation effectively.
